Default Forward No Answer Timeout
Time, in milliseconds, the telephone keeps ringing before the
call forwarding activates.
If a specific configuration is set in the
EpSpecificForwardNoAnswer.Timeout parameter and the
EpSpecificForwardNoAnswer.EnableConfig parameter is set to
'Enable', then it overrides the current default configuration.
